The Detroit Lions’ Victory and Amik Robertson’s Standout Performance

The Detroit Lions delivered a monumental win on Sunday night, securing a 31-9 victory over the Minnesota Vikings. This triumph not only sealed the NFC’s No. 1 seed for the Lions but also clinched their second consecutive division title. But beyond the team’s collective effort, one standout performance caught the attention of fans and analysts alike—cornerback Amik Robertson’s shutdown coverage of one of the league’s most formidable receivers, Justin Jefferson.

Amik Robertson’s Dominant Display Against Justin Jefferson

When it comes to elite wide receivers, few in the NFL compare to Justin Jefferson. Known for his incredible route running and ability to make spectacular catches, Jefferson is often considered the best in the league. So, when Robertson was assigned the task of covering him, expectations were high. The result? A performance that exceeded even the most optimistic projections.

Robertson’s lockdown coverage was nothing short of impressive. He held Jefferson to just three receptions for 54 yards on nine targets, a stark contrast to the explosive plays Jefferson is known for. The most defining moment came in the end zone when Robertson nearly intercepted a pass that could have resulted in a touchdown for Jefferson. It was a testament to his coverage skills and determination to not let his opponent get the better of him.

A Rivalry Rekindled: Robertson vs. Jefferson

Robertson and Jefferson share a history that dates back to their high school days. The two players have faced off numerous times, but it was their Week 7 matchup this season that truly stood out. In that game, Jefferson caught a touchdown over Robertson, and afterward, the Vikings star offered a simple “Good game” to his defender—a gesture of sportsmanship.

Fast forward to Week 18, and the situation had changed. After Robertson’s stellar performance and the Lions’ victory over the Vikings, Jefferson did not reciprocate the sportsmanship. Instead, he walked off the field without a word. Robertson, understandably, took this personally. He admitted that the lack of acknowledgment “rubbed him the wrong way,” especially considering their history and the competitive nature of their rivalry.
